    The first Woolworths store opened its doors to the public in Cape Town in October 1931. And it was founder Max Sonnenberg who captured the public’s imagination with dynamic store policies that set Woolworths apart from its competitors. Three years later, a second branch opened in Durban, with another two in Port Elizabeth and Johannesburg a year later....

    Tax Accountant

    MAIN PURPOSE:

    • To ensure that the Woolworths Group complies with the tax legislation, providing advice to the business, and to ensure that various statutory returns are completed and submitted according to legislative and SARS requirements.

    K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

    • Assist with reviewing and advising African country subsidiaries with tax matters (income tax, VAT, Customs duty, Payroll taxes).
    • Keep up to date with the African tax legislation, and investigate changes that impact Woolworths. Inform the African subsidiaries. Ensure updates are implemented.
    • Assist with the drafting of the SA VAT returns and ensure it is completed timeously and that all required schedules have been completed and submitted.
    • Assist with the SA tax returns and ensure it is completed timeously and that all required schedules have been completed and submitted.
    • Manage the relationship with SARS and respond to SARS queries.
    • Manage and deal with tax advisors.
    • Manage the group’s efiling profile.
    • Ad hoc assistance where required.
    • Reconcile tax general ledger accounts.
    • Assist with providing analytical evidence of group tax compliance. Continuously monitor systems and processes, including change initiatives and training, to ensure compliance.
    • Maintain up-to-date, detailed knowledge of trends and changes in SA Tax legislation by reading, regular attendance of professional courses, workshops, etc.
    • Assist with annually updating the transfer pricing documents for each of the African subsidiaries. And performing the detailed tax return TP reconciliations required.
    • Managing the weekly tax technical meetings.
    • Assist with the yearend process for income tax and VAT.

    KEY COMPETENCIES

    Technical Skills:

    • BComm (Accounting) it would be advantageous to also have a Higher diploma in taxation
    • Understanding of the tax legislation
    • Understanding of IFRS/GAAP
    • Preferably tax compliance experience.
